valsi jvaiso
type fu'ivla
creator krtisfranks
time entered Wed Jun 25 05:26:48 2014

Examples
   
English
Definition #56918 - Preferred [edit]
   
definition x1 is the ISO designation/result/standard/code for topic x2 applied to specific case/individual/group/thing x3 according to rule/ISO specification x4 published by/according to mandating organization x5 (default: ISO)
notes Theoretically, the standard organization/body could be other than ISO, but it should be prominent and/or international (and internationally recognized) in scope and nature; in such a case, replace each occurrence of "ISO" in the definition with the appropriate name/designation/title (of the organization, etc.). x1 need not be a name-designation/code (it could be the result of any rule), although it likely will commonly be so. Examples of possible x2-filling sumti: code-designations for language, country, currency, etc.. For an entity with a given code, use te jvaiso or te se jvaiso (specifying the type of entity being designated by use of the appropriate terbri j2); for a given ISO rule, consider ve jvaiso; for the organization ISO, consider xe jvaiso. See also: linga, landa, rucni, jvinjiata, jvinjica'o. This word is the fu'ivla version of: jviso; equivalent to javniso.
